Primary Outcome Measures
NameTimeMethod
1. To assess the effect of GH therapy on:<br /> <br>a. linear growth;<br /> <br>b. bone maturation;<br /> <br>c. pubertal development;<br /> <br>d. final height;<br /> <br>in children with IUGR and no catch-up growth.
Secondary Outcome Measures
NameTimeMethod
1. To assess the relation between 24-hour plasma GH profiles and the effect of GH therapy with two doses of GH;<br /><br>2. To assess the additional affects of GH therapy on glucose and lipid metabolism, blood pressure, procollagen-I and III, plasma IGF-I and IGF-binding protein 3 (IGFBP-3);<br /><br>3. Psychosocial functioning;<br /> <br>4. Intelligence.
